    Lower back pain, down the back of left leg into groin
    Why do I get pain in my lower back, down the back of my left leg and wraps around my innner thigh into my groin. I've tried stretches to release tension on my sciatica. It worked for a little bit after I did the stretches but that was it. NSAIDS work for a short period. Heat nor cold helps. Pain levels normal 4-5 when I go to get up it is 7-8. Breaking my neck was a 10 on the pain scale. I am 34 yrs old male.

    You can go to a medical doctor, get x-rays, maybe an MRI, and possibly get muscle relaxants, pain pills, and physical therapy. Or you can go to a chiropractor, get x-rays and probably an MRI, and treatments to correct any misalignments of your spine that may be pressing on nerves. Somehow, you care going to have to relieve the pressure on nerves. AND there might be something else or in addition to going on, so please start with the M.D.
